What results in a blocked nose while pregnant?

Contents show

Having an excessive amount of fluid in the body: During pregnancy, the body produces more blood and fluids, which can cause swelling, even in unexpected locations like the nasal passages. This swelling can be caused by having an excessive amount of fluid in the body. This extra volume can cause blood vessels in the nose to expand, which can make it difficult to breathe through the nose.

How do I clear my nose while expecting?

If you’re having trouble breathing through your nose, you should try using saline nasal spray or saline nose drops three to four times a day. You may get them at any pharmacy that sells over-the-counter medications, or you can prepare a saline solution at home by combining one cup of warm water, half a teaspoon of salt, and a sprinkle of baking soda.

Is a blocked nose common during pregnancy?

An inflammation of the mucous membranes that line the nose is what is known as pregnancy rhinitis. This leads to congestion in the nasal passages. There is also a contribution from an increase in blood flow to the nasal passages as well as an expansion of the nasal veins. The symptoms appear while the woman is pregnant.

When does the typical onset of nasal congestion during pregnancy often occur? There is no set time when pregnant rhinitis first manifests itself; nevertheless, it is most common during the 13th or 21st week of pregnancy. It can endure for up to six weeks or even longer, and many individuals continue to experience it till after they have given birth. In most cases, it will go away within the first two weeks after the delivery of the baby.

Which nasal spray is risk-free for pregnant women?

Budesonide nasal spray is offered under a variety of brand names, including Rhinocort Aqua, Entocort, and Pulmicort. It is only accessible with a doctor’s prescription. Rhinocort Allergy is an alternative brand name that may be purchased without a prescription. In addition, mometasone (Nasonex) and fluticasone propionate are medications that may be taken throughout pregnancy without risking the baby’s health (Flonase).

Why do I always have a blocked nose at night?

Alterations in Blood Flow

When you lie down, there is a shift in the pressure of your blood. Additionally, there is a possibility that the blood flow to the top half of your body, especially the blood flow to your head and nasal passageways, will rise. Because of the increased blood flow, the blood vessels inside of your nose and nasal passages might get inflamed, which can either create congestion or make it worse.

Why do newborns cry at the time of birth?

Babies are typically prompted to cry as soon as they are delivered because they are placed in an unfamiliar setting and must endure the frigid air. The infant’s lungs will expand as a result of this cry, and it will also cause the baby to cough up mucous and amniotic fluid. The fact that the infant is able to cry for the first time is evidence that their lungs are developing normally.

Is paracetamol safe to take while pregnant?

1 Despite the fact that it is known that paracetamol may pass through the human placenta, there is no evidence that it causes foetal difficulties in animal models; hence, it is seen to be a safe medicine to use during pregnancy. 2 Because of this, paracetamol is the analgesic medication that is prescribed to pregnant women as a first choice.

When ought I to begin consuming folic acid?

It is suggested that you take folic acid when you are attempting to get pregnant (preferably, for three months prior), as well as during the first 12 weeks of your pregnancy. Folic acid helps prevent neural tube defects. A single daily dosage of 400 micrograms is the recommended amount to take if you are attempting to conceive a child or are within the first 12 weeks of your pregnancy.
